Page 1 sur 1
for
Publié : mer. févr. 26, 2014 10:49 am
par frederic han
Si l'on n'est etourdi et que l'on n'initialise pas x:
la boucle suivante ne s'arrete pas toute seule et ca devient dangereux.
Fred
Re: for
Publié : mer. févr. 26, 2014 11:37 am
par parisse
Je n'ai malheureusement pas d'idee pour empecher ca, meme en changeant le niveau d'evaluation en interactif a chaque evaluation ca va remplacer x autant de fois par sa valeur precedente, il n'y a qu'en niveau 1 que ca ne posera pas probleme (c'est le niveau dans les programmes), mais en general les gens ont envie d'avoir plusieurs remplacements de variables par leur valeur en mode interactif.
Re: for
Publié : jeu. févr. 27, 2014 9:35 am
par frederic han
Oui en mode interactif les gens aiment bien:
mais par contre xcas detecte les definitions recursives,
dans quel genre d'exemple est ce utile d'autoriser une definition recursive qui ne soit pas une fonction?
Fred
Re: for
Publié : jeu. févr. 27, 2014 10:03 am
par parisse
excellente question, je pense que ca n'est utile nulle part, du coup je pourrais transformer le warning en erreur dans ce cas.